Understanding Landscaping Services: What You Need to Know

Though many homeowners value the visual appeal of a neatly kept yard, they may not fully understand the variety of landscaping services available. Landscaping encompasses a variety of try this tasks, from design and installation to maintenance and renovation. This can include offerings such as planting trees, shrubs, and flowers, creating garden beds, and putting down sod or artificial turf. Moreover, hardscaping elements like patios, walkways, and retaining walls also fall under this umbrella, improving outdoor utility and visual appeal.

Effective landscaping relies on irrigation systems and drainage solutions as essential components, guaranteeing plants get sufficient water while avoiding flooding. Seasonal maintenance services, such as lawn mowing, pruning, and mulching, help keep outdoor spaces looking pristine year-round. Grasping these different options allows homeowners to make well-informed decisions, adapting their landscaping projects to fulfill their individual needs and preferences while enhancing the aesthetic appeal and worth of their properties.

Assessing Your Space

To establish a dream garden, one must first examine the available space meticulously. This assessment involves measuring the area, assessing sunlight exposure, and identifying existing features such as trees, slopes, and soil quality. Understanding the microclimates within the space is critical, as different sections may receive varying amounts of light and moisture. In addition, analyzing the surrounding environment, including adjacent properties and local wildlife, can shape design choices. Accessibility should also be evaluated, ensuring pathways and seating areas are functional and inviting. By taking these factors into account, one can build a solid foundation for designing a garden that harmonizes with its surroundings while meeting personal aesthetic and functional expectations.

Selecting Appropriate Plants

How can someone pick the right plants to elevate their garden's aesthetic appeal and practicality? As a first step, it is vital to assess the local climate and soil conditions, as plants need to thrive in specific environments. Picking native plants can be valuable, as they are acclimated to the local ecosystem and require less maintenance. In addition, the gardener should consider the amount of sunlight the area receives each day, as this will determine which plants are suitable. Another consideration is the desired aesthetic; a variety of colors, textures, and heights can create visual attraction. In conclusion, it is vital to consider the growth habits of plants, ensuring they have adequate space to flourish without overcrowding.

Landscape Lighting Options

A variety of landscape lighting solutions can turn outdoor spaces into stunning environments, accentuating features and creating focal points that improve the overall aesthetic. Pathway lights provide safety and elegance, leading visitors through gardens and yards. Uplighting can emphasize trees, sculptures, or architectural elements, creating dramatic shadows and depth. Spotlights focus attention on specific features, while downlights imitate moonlight, offering a serene ambiance. String lights add a whimsical touch, excellent for patios or outdoor dining areas. Solar lights offer an eco-friendly solution, requiring no wiring and ensuring flexibility in placement. By merging different lighting approaches, homeowners can craft an inviting atmosphere that displays their landscape's beauty and functionality, making it delightful both day and night.

Advantages of Water Features

Adding water features to a landscape design can substantially enhance the overall appeal and ambiance of outdoor spaces. These components, such as fountains, ponds, and waterfalls, not only act as beautiful focal points but also create a peaceful atmosphere. The sound of flowing water can block unwanted noise, promoting relaxation and enhancing the outdoor experience. Moreover, water features attract wildlife, including birds and beneficial insects, fostering a thriving ecosystem. They can also boost air quality and humidity levels, making the environment more pleasant. Furthermore, water features can boost property value, attracting potential buyers seeking a serene retreat. Ultimately, thoughtfully placed water features can transform an ordinary landscape into an extraordinary sanctuary.

Landscaping Success: Seasonal Tips

In what ways can homeowners effectively adapt their landscaping strategies throughout the year? Seasonal changes necessitate distinct approaches to guarantee optimal outdoor aesthetics and health. In spring, homeowners should prioritize planting flowers, pruning trees, and applying fertilizer to stimulate growth. This is also an ideal time for re-establishing lawns and preparing garden beds.

Summer requires steady watering and mulching to preserve moisture and prevent weeds. Regular mowing is essential to maintain lawn health and appearance.

With the arrival of autumn, homeowners should consider raking leaves, planting perennials, and removing debris to ensure winter readiness. This is also the time to apply fertilizer to the lawn and garden for better winter survival.

In winter, preventive steps become critical. Homeowners should cover sensitive plants, inspect for cold weather damage, and organize their garden projects for the next year, providing a successful transition into spring.

What Permits Are Needed for Landscaping Projects?

When undertaking landscaping projects, one might need permits for tree removal, significant grading, or building structures. Because local ordinances differ, reaching out to the city or zoning office is necessary to confirm compliance with all essential permits.
